Fire safety is never a one-size-fits-all solution. Depending on the materials in your building, we supply and fit a complete range of certified fire extinguishers:
Best For: Organic solid materials like wood, paper, cardboard, textiles, and soft furnishings (Class A fires). Foam units are also effective on flammable liquids (Class B).
Common Uses: Offices, schools, corridors, warehouses, and residential common areas.
Best For: Electrical equipment fires (Class E) and flammable liquids (Class B).
Common Uses: Server rooms, electrical intake cupboards, computer labs, and plant rooms. They leave zero residue, preventing damage to sensitive electronics.
Best For: Multi-risk environments involving solids, liquids, gases (Class A, B, and C), and electrical hazards.
Common Uses: Industrial workshops, garages, construction sites, and outdoor storage spaces.
Best For: High-temperature cooking oil and fat fires (Class F).
Common Uses: Commercial kitchens, restaurants, hotels, and canteen spaces.

Under Irish standards (IS 291), commercial fire extinguishers must undergo a formal professional inspection at least once a year. In addition to annual servicing, building owners should perform quick monthly visual checks to ensure pressure gauges are in the green zone, pins are intact, and units aren’t blocked.
It depends entirely on what is inside your building. For example, an office with computers needs CO2 and Water/Foam units, while a commercial kitchen requires Wet Chemical extinguishers. Our engineers perform on-site risk assessments to determine the exact mix and placement for your space.
Most fire extinguishers have a operational life of 10 years, provided they pass their annual checks. Many types (like water, foam, and powder) require an extended service or discharge test at the 5-year mark to verify structural integrity.
